ENGLEWOOD -- Denver Broncos third-round pick Jeremy LeSueur has had a rough start to training camp. LeSueur is listed as a fourth- string cornerback on the Broncos' depth chart, and that list doesn't include injured starter Lenny Walls. LeSueur is working behind undrafted free agent rookie Roc Alexander (Wasson) and rookie fifth- round pick Jeff Shoate, among others.

"(He's) struggling," defensive coordinator Larry Coyer said. "But he's going to have to fight through it. That's his lot in life. He's coming, he's developing, but this thing is fast." Coyer said LeSueur was having trouble adjusting to playing man-to-man coverage after he played mostly zone at Michigan. During Friday morning's practice, LeSueur was beat by Atnaf Harris in the end zone on a post route. Later in an 11-on-11 drill, he was beat deep by rookie Triandos Luke. "At first it was hard," LeSueur said. "I'm starting to pick it up now. It's coming along. It's not easy, it's a different adjustment, but you have to keep working hard."
